Condenser Fan: Service and Repair

CONDENSER AND CONDENSER FAN MOTOR

Pre-Removal And Post-Installation Operation:




Removal Steps 1-11:




RE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ION

NOTE: For removal and installation of the condenser fan motor refer Engine Cooling - Radiator.

REMOVAL SERVICE POINTS




<> RESERVE TANK ASSEMBLY REMOVAL
Position the reserve tank assembly out of the way. The reserve tank assembly cannot be removed completely from the engine compartment.

<> FLEXIBLE SUCTION HOSE AND LIQUID PIPE A DISCONNECTION

CAUTION: As the compressor oil and receiver are highly moisture absorbent, use a non-porous material to plug the hose and nipples.

To prevent the entry of dust or other foreign bodies, plug the dismantled hose and condenser assembly nipples.

INSTALLATION SERVICE POINT

>>A<< CONDENSER INSTALLATION
When replacing the condenser, refill it with a specified amount of compressor oil and install it to the vehicle.
- Compressor oil: SUN PAG 56
- Quantity: 15 cubic.cm (0.5 fl.oz)
